The norm for Figma packing.<\/p>\n<p><img loading=\"lazy\" decoding=\"async\" class=\"alignnone\" src=\"https:\/\/arcticukitsu.com\/Blog\/blogpics\/May\/P1020355.jpg\" alt=\"\" width=\"214\" height=\"320\" \/><\/p>\n<p>(Link &#8211; <a href=\"https:\/\/arcticukitsu.com\/Blog\/blogpics\/May\/P1020355.jpg\" target=\"_blank\">MySite<\/a>)<\/p>\n<p>Ein in her first pose out of the box and plastic case.\u00c2\u00a0 Poses quite well but her shoulders don&#8217;t allow much flexibility when trying to hold a gun or a sword with both arms. All the joints were nice and stiff, no loose or defective areas to report.\u00c2\u00a0 Her sandals are painted in.<\/p>\n<p><img loading=\"lazy\" decoding=\"async\" class=\"alignnone\" src=\"https:\/\/arcticukitsu.com\/Blog\/blogpics\/May\/P1020357.jpg\" alt=\"\" width=\"213\" height=\"320\" \/><\/p>\n<p>(Link &#8211; <a href=\"https:\/\/arcticukitsu.com\/Blog\/blogpics\/May\/P1020357.jpg\" target=\"_blank\">MySite<\/a>)<\/p>\n<p>Her hands are pegs which might cause paranoid Figma owners who photoshoot their Figmas to be alert at all times.
